Management Meeting Minutes — 14th sitting. Attendees: regional directors and branch oversight committee. Main item: the proposed acquisition of Fenholt Supply Co. Discussion covered valuation ranges, overlap with our Dunmarsh branches, and retention of Fenholt's warehouse staff. Legal review is underway; no binding offer yet. Branch managers must route all inquiries to head office and avoid speculation with staff. The confidential strategic rationale is recorded below.

management briefing: Goroxix Systems is in early talks to buy Kelethek Holdings for about $118.0 million. The Sileth launch date is February 25, and nothing goes to the press before then. Legal wants the Pelokox Logistics term sheet withdrawn before December 14.

Second-Source Supplier Search — Manager Wiki (Restricted)

Status for the board: Procurement has shortlisted two alternates to Quillhart Metals for the Ardenfall casing line — Bexton Alloys and Roukehaven Works. Sample runs complete by quarter-end; qualification testing follows. Single-source risk remains high until then. The confidential sourcing strategy appears below.

board note of kageg-bahof: The renewal with Holwynax Holdings closes at $2 million a year, 5 percent below the last contract. Project Ulaath slips by two quarters because of the supplier delay.

## Formula sandbox tuning

User-supplied formulas in Gridmoor execute inside a restricted interpreter with hard ceilings on time, memory, and call depth. Reviewers should confirm any change to these ceilings is justified in the PR description, since raising them widens the abuse surface. Defaults were chosen from production traces. The current limits are as follows.

limits module of tafog-fawip:
WEIGHTS = {
    "julix": 57,
    "lamys": 992,
    "kasvan": 209,
    "quenok": 750,
    "alddor": 259,
    "oliath": 1009,
    "wenix": 815,
}

Subject: Partner SFTP drop — new owner

Hi,

As you review the pending changes to the Harborline ingest scripts, note that ownership of the partner SFTP drop is changing at the end of the month. This includes key rotation, the nightly pull job, and the quarantine folder for malformed files. Review comments on the retry logic should still go through the normal PR flow, but questions about drop-folder conventions or partner onboarding now go to the new owner. The incoming owner is listed below.

signatory, tagaf-bahaf: Praael Fenmir Rusok